WebFeb 19, 2024 · Stability of Air. Adiabatic temperature change is an important factor in determining the stability of the air. We can think of air stability as the tendency for air to rise or fall through the atmosphere under its own "power". Stable air has a tendency to resist movement. On the other hand, unstable air will easily rise.
